Piano Removals
Piano Removals in Queensbury by Man and Van Queensbury
Moving a piano is never just another job. It is a heavy, delicate, and often sentimental instrument that needs experienced hands and the right equipment. At Man and Van Queensbury, our dedicated piano removals team provides a safe, efficient and fully managed service for every type of piano move in and around Queensbury.
Specialist Piano Removals Service Explained
Our piano removals service is designed specifically for upright, digital and grand pianos. We understand the combination of awkward weight, fragile internal mechanisms and often tight access. We use purpose-built skates, padded covers, ramps, and, when needed, additional manpower or specialist lifting to protect both your piano and your property.
Every move is planned in advance. We assess access, stairs, flooring and doorways so that on the day everything runs smoothly. Your piano is wrapped, protected, secured in our vehicle and transported with care, then placed exactly where you want it at the destination.

Our Step-by-Step Piano Removals Process
1. Enquiry & Quotation
You contact us with basic details: piano type, current address, destination, floor levels and any access concerns. We provide a clear, no-obligation quotation, usually the same day. Prices are based on distance, access difficulty, piano type and any extra services you request.
2. Survey – Virtual or Onsite
For straightforward moves, a video call and some photos are usually enough. For more complex access, such as tight staircases, many steps or awkward turns, we may visit in person. The survey lets us confirm feasibility, plan the safest route and agree any additional support needed.
3. Packing & Preparation
On the day, we protect floors where needed and prepare the piano. This may include removing music stands, securing lids and, for some grands, carefully removing legs and pedals. The piano is then wrapped in padded covers, with edges and corners given extra protection.
4. Loading & Transport
Using the correct number of trained movers, we carefully manoeuvre the piano on specialist skates and trolleys, taking care around corners, steps and doorframes. It is then loaded via ramp or tail lift, secured firmly in the vehicle and transported steadily, avoiding harsh braking and uneven routes where possible.
5. Unloading & Placement
At the destination we reverse the process, taking the same care with access. We place the piano in your chosen room and position, making minor adjustments until you are satisfied. Wrapping is removed, and we carry out a visual check for you before we leave. We recommend allowing the piano to settle before booking a tuner.

How much does a piano removal in Queensbury cost?
The cost of a piano removal depends on the type of piano, access at each property and the distance between addresses. Upright pianos on ground-floor to ground-floor moves are usually the most straightforward and therefore the most cost-effective. Moves involving multiple flights of stairs, tight turns, or baby grands and grand pianos require more planning, manpower and time, which increases the price. We provide a clear fixed quotation after asking a few questions or completing a brief survey, so you know the full cost before you commit.
